Press Release NASA’s Johnson Space Center: - Space Station Investigation Goes With the Flow "...It could also impact the medical community on Earth, especially for physicians treating patients with chronic heart failure and neurological disorders. The strain-gauge plethysmography, complemented by ultrasound analysis of the jugular pulse, could potentially make measuring blood flow in these sets of patients much easier, allowing patients and doctors to better go with the flow..." http://www.nasa.gov/mission_pages/station/research/news/drain-BraintreeOn Earth, blood flows down from a person’s brain back toward the heart thanks in part to gravity, but very little is known about how this flow happens in microgravity.
